Question 210434: A and B are complimentary angles. If angle B is 3 times as large as angle A, what is the size of angle A?

From the information given, you can write 2 equations:
--------------
Equation #1: A%2BB=90
Equation #2: B=3A
--------------
Substitute the expression for B from Equation #2 into Equation #1:
A%2B3A=90
Solve for A and you are done!
4A=90
highlight%28A=22.5%29
